The oil we present is produced by cold-pressing the roasted coffee beans of Coffea Arabica. It contains caffeine, fruit acids, phytostelore, carotenes, vitamins (especially E) and a wealth of antioxidants. It stimulates the process of lipolysis by breaking down adipose tissue, has an anti-inflammatory, detoxifying, anti-ageing effect, soothes irritation, helps fight free radicals.
